Hadith 1198
- " حد يعمل به في الأرض خير لأهل الأرض من أن يمطروا أربعين صباحا ".
Sayyiduna Abu Hurairah (may Allah be pleased with him) reports that the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him) said: "One prescribed legal punishment (hadd) that is carried out on the earth (upon its inhabitants) is better for the people of the earth than forty days of rain."

Hadith 1199
- " الشيخ والشيخة إذا زنيا فارجموهما البتة ".
The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him) said: "When a married man and woman commit adultery, then stone them in any case." This hadith is narrated from Sayyiduna Umar, Sayyiduna Zaid bin Thabit, Sayyiduna Ubayy bin Ka'b, and the aunt of Abu Umamah bin Sahl, Sayyidah Ajma' (may Allah be pleased with them). It is narrated from Sayyiduna Ibn Abbas (may Allah be pleased with them both) that Sayyiduna Umar (may Allah be pleased with him) said: I fear that after a long time has passed, someone will say that we did not find the command of stoning in the Book of Allah, and thus they will go astray by abandoning an obligation imposed by Allah. Be aware! Stoning the married adulterer is a right, when witnesses testify, or the woman's pregnancy becomes evident, or the criminal himself confesses. I myself had recited (this verse): «الشيخ والشيخة» etc. The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him) stoned, and after him, we also stoned.
